The International Budo Academy is an independent educational institute founded by like-minded Martial Artists who have been practicing Budo for many years. The Academy prepares Martial Artists for quality teaching and certifies instructors, teachers and masters of various levels. The Academy also offers a range of academic degrees, including a PhD in Martial Arts.

 

The Academy has set to itself the goal to broaden the professional horizons of Senior Budoka, to encourage research, writing and preservation of classical Budo.  The Academy functions as an independent professional union with the goal of upgrading, developing and improving the education of its members and students, and has set down a professional code of ethics, promoting the public image of the classical Martial Arts and Martial Artists.

 

The International Budo Academy is approved & accredited by the Ministry of Education, Culture and Sport to train,  qualify and officially authorize.

Academic degrees:  The International Budo Academy offers the chance to earn an academic degree in the Martial Arts.  Three degrees are offered:  B.A., M.A and Ph.D.  The student studying towards a degree chooses a domain to focus on, from teaching studies, Martial Arts research, Martial Arts history, style analysis and the philosophy and ethics of Budo.

Instructor and Teacher Qualification:  The Academy offers comprehensive training for Martial Arts teachers and instructors.  Five types of qualifications are available:  Assistant Instructor, Instructor, Teacher, Senior Teacher and Master, each with its own set of theoretical course requirements and practical training experience requirements.

Accreditation of Martial Arts Degrees:  The Academy validates and accredits Dan degrees as well as Dan degree upgrades, providing an official stamp of approval for a Martial Artist’s knowledge and experience.

Registration of Martial Arts Schools:  Professional Martial Arts schools may be registered at the Academy and thus affiliated with the Academy and its members.  Registration requires submission of valid school and teacher credentials.
